New Zealand - Re-Import of Pumps for Dispensing Fuel or Lubricants Used in Filling-Stations or in Garages
Since 2014, New Zealand Re-Import of Pumps for Dispensing Fuel or Lubricants Used in Filling-Stations or in Garages was up 19.4% year on year. At $76,036.59 in 2019, the country was ranked number 2 comparing other countries in Re-Import of Pumps for Dispensing Fuel or Lubricants Used in Filling-Stations or in Garages. Thailand ranked the highest with $274,050.15 in 2019, a decrease of 19.6% compared to 2018. South Africa witnessed the best average annual growth at +74.5% per year, while Italy recorded the worst performance at -73.1% per year.
